Árvore de páginas

Versões comparadas

Chave

  • Esta linha foi adicionada.
  • Esta linha foi removida.
  • A formatação mudou.

API responsável por alterar o status da troca

Para acessar os dados a requisição é a seguinte

  • Endpoint: /api/pdvsyncclient/v2/trocamensagens
  • Método: PUT
  • Autenticação: Bearer token
  • Permissão: Client

O endpoint recebe uma lista de vendas para que seja possivel enviar várias na mesma requisição

Expandir
titleExemplo de body da requisição

[
    {
        "idMensagem": "string",
        "observacao": "string",
        "status": 0
    }
]

Expandir
titleDefinição dos campos de requisição

Campo

Tipo

Descrição

Observações

idMensagemStringIdentificador da Trocano POSH

Obrigatório

observacaoStringObservação enviada pela retaguarda

Opcional

statusIntStatus da venda (Definições abaixo)

Opcional

Expandir
titleStatus
CódigoStatusDescrição
0ProcessarPendente consumo pela retaguarda
1ProcessadaConsumido pela retaguarda
2ErroConsumido com erro pela retaguarda
3ReprocessarPara reprocessar
4IntegradoComSucessoIntegrado com sucesso pela retaguarda
Expandir
titleDefinição dos campos de retorno
Expandir
title200 - Ok

Campo

Tipo

Descrição

SuccessboolIndica se a criação do compartilhamento foi feita com sucesso
MessagestringCaso ocorra erros durante a criação do compartilhamento eles serão enviados nesse campo
DataobjetoObjeto compartilhamento criado
ErrorsListaListas com os erros encontrados no processo
TotalTimeinttempo da requisição
NumberOfRecordsintnúmero de dados inseridos
Expandir
title400 - Bad Request

Campo

Tipo

Descrição

SuccessboolIndica se a criação do compartilhamento foi feita com sucesso
MessagestringCaso ocorra erros durante a criação do compartilhamento eles serão enviados nesse campo
DataobjetoObjeto compartilhamento criado
ErrorsListaListas com os erros encontrados no processo
TotalTimeinttempo da requisição
NumberOfRecordsintnúmero de dados inseridos